Serum insulin level, disease stage, prostate specific antigen (PSA) and Gleason score in prostate cancer
In the present study, we assessed the relationship of serum insulin levels and three surrogate markers of recurrence, T stage, PSA, and Gleason score, in men with localized prostate cancer.
